Dylan Henegar

I'm originally from Laurens, I just haven't been back in town much for several years. I stopped in on 6/30 to get some lunch, opting to bypass the chain fast-food establishments in favor of a local small business. I cannot lie, I was shocked a bit at the price for a Giant Cheeseburger plate with fries and slaw as sides with a large Sweet Tea, almost $17. But I am not one who minds paying a little more for quality and it is a local business too so it is justifiable to me personally. But I digress, the food took a little bit to get out, but again no worries as that means it should be fresh. Let me say, this was the BEST Giant Cheeseburger I have eaten from Whiteford's in a long time. The tomato, onions and lettuce were fresh fresh, the patty was thick and super fresh tasting. Shockingly, the patty filled up the bun! That is a rarity in a burger anywhere these days. The condiments were not too heavy nor too light, perfectly complimenting the burger. The slaw was fresh, great mix and good flavor even without adding s&p. But the fries, oh the FRIES! The fries were FANTASTIC! The perfect crispy outside with soft, fluffy inside...and they were even just as tasty as they cooled off, unlike most fast food fries.

All in all, I didn't plan on writing a review, but this meal, even at the price point, was 5 stars. Give yourselves a tremendous pat on the back!

And if you find yourself in town, grab you a Giant Cheeseburger and a Tea!
